    How about looking at the following (NS units notoriously had top-mounted ditchlights):

    NS Dash 9's (Kato's only offered ditchlights on the pilots, and no anti-climbers on the rear)
    [​IMG]

    SD40-2 (Some Kato SD40-2 models had ditchlights in front but not in back)
    [​IMG]

    So, I'm thinking that the anti-climbers for the SD40-2 would cover a huge range of Spartan Cab style EMD's, and Dash 9 anti-climbers would cover probably most if not all of the wide cabs. The problem (at least for me) with trying to simply glue top-mounted ditchlight housings has been trying to glue them to the delrin walkway pieces. Delrin is self-lubricating and is therefore hard to bond to. Being that the housings stick up and have nothing the brace against, the surface area being bonded is very small. So the frustration comes from the difficulty of bonding and the ease of breakage afterword. My thought is if you make an anti-climber complete with the pair of supports on the underside, and the ditchlights built-in on the top, one could cut away an existing's models anti-climber (if equipped) and simply glue your part onto it. Usually the part of the model that the Delrin walkway snaps onto and includes the pilot and anti-climber is much easier to bond to. You could leave the back of the ditchlights hollow so they will accept LED's. The only other request I would have is that you leave the top of the anti-climber with a recess on the top (just like on the model) so that it will accept the original walkway. One could simply snip the original walkway a bit to fit over the new ditchlight housings.

    For anybody looking to try out the new Micro Trains True Scale Couplers without being restricted to just the 1015 box, I have also uploaded a short and extended coupler box made specifically for the TSC. The main difference is the addition of the front pin where the shanks engage the box.
